Post on 10-Aug-2015
Escuela Colombiana de Carreras Industriales
Sistemas Operativos Presentado Por: Edgar Andrey López
Clavijo Diana Milena Morales
Guevara
MODELOS DE ESTADOS Y
TRANSICIONES
MODELOS DE DOS ESTADOS
ENTRAR NO EJECUCIONUn proceso que esta en
espera para ser ejecutado en ese momento entra en
uso de la memoria principal
Expedir
Pausar
EJECUCIONEn ejecución un proceso
entra a utilizar el procesador
SALIR
MODELOS DE TRES ESTADOS
ADMITIR LISTOSE CREA LA LISTA
DE PROCESOS QUE SE VAN A EJECUTAR
Expedir
Fin de tiempo
EJECUCION
TERMINADO
BLOQUEOEntra en estado de bloqueo cuando es
imposible ejecutarlo, tal proceso espera a que
suceda un suceso que corrija la ejecución
OCURRE SUCESO
ESPERA DE
SUCESO
MODELO DE CINCO ESTADOS
AdmitirLISTO
Expendir
Fin de tiempo
EJECUCIONSolo un proceso
se esta ejecutando
SALIR
BLOQUEOEl proceso no se puede ejecutar hasta que no ocurra cierto
proceso, como una operación de
entrada y salida
OCURRE SUCESO
ESPERA DE
SUCESO
NUEVO Aquí se crea la
lista de los procesos recién
creados y que no han sido cargados en el procesador
TERMINADOAquí se crea
la lista de los procesos
ya ejecutados
MODELOS DE SEIS ESTADOS
AdmitirLISTO
Expandir
Fin de Plazo
EJECUCIONSALIR
BLOQUEO
OCURRE SUCESO
ESPERA DE
SUCESO
NUEVO TERMINAR
SUSPENDER
SUSPENDIDOCuando un
proceso lleva mucho tiempo
bloqueado pasa a ser suspendido
hasta su activación
Activar
MODELOS DE SIETE ESTADOS MODELO DE DOS ESTADOS DE SUSPENSIÓN
Activar LISTOEJECUCION
SALIR
BLOQUEO
OC
UR
RE
SU
CE
SO
ESPERA
DE SUCESO
LISTO Y SUSPENDIDO TERMINAR
BLOQUEADO/ SUSPENDIDO
Suspende
r
Expedir
Fin de
plazo
Activar
Suspende
r
OC
UR
RE
SU
CE
SO
NUEVO
Admitir Admitir